Digital MEMS Inclinometer with Full Temperature Compensation

Introducing the JDI-100/200 inclinometer series, the latest addition to Jewell Instruments’ group of MEMS sensors. Made in-house, this ruggedized inclinometer includes digital output and full temperature compensation across all measuring ranges which enables the unit to perform to 0.005° accuracy. New Geotechnical Tiltmeter with MEMS Technology

Introducing the 850 MEMS Tuff Tilt Series, the latest addition to Jewell Instruments’ electrolytic tiltmeter line for geophysical & geotechnical applications. This versatile, rugged, weatherproof tiltmeter is a low-cost alternative to most sensors for the geotechnical market. JMA & JMI Models Now Offer 4-20mA Output

The JMA-100/200/300 accelerometer and JMI-100/200 inclinometer series, the latest additions to Jewell Instruments’ MEMS sensor line, are now available with 4-20mA output (JMA-L, JMI-L). This output option provides ease of use, particularly for applications that rely on long cable runs. LCF-2330 Inclinometer with 4-20mA Output

The LCF-2330 inclinometer series now includes a 4-20mA output signal option for applications that require long cable runs. This dual-axis tilt sensor is fluid damped to minimize noise and vibration interference while also offering a sharp 1 µradian resolution.
